We compared two Professional market GPUs: 8GB VRAM Tesla P4 and 4GB VRAM Tesla T10 Processor to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
Tesla P4 's Advantages
Released 7 years and 5 months late
Boost Clock1114MHz
More VRAM (8GB vs 4GB)
Larger VRAM bandwidth (192.3GB/s vs 102.4GB/s)
2320 additional rendering cores
Lower TDP (75W vs 188W)
